UVA Information Technology Services (ITS) is seeking an experienced Integrations Developer to join the Document Imaging and Productivity Services group within Enterprise Applications.  The Integrations Developer will provide dedicated support for Perceptive Content (ImageNow) and DocuSign, two essential tools for our organization's enterprise applications.

As an Integrations Developer, you will be responsible for all aspects of the Software Development Lifecycle (Planning, Requirements, Design, Code, Test, Deploy, Maintain). Expertise is needed in creating/updating scripts for customization in Perceptive Content. And creating/updating integrations for Perceptive Content and DocuSign. Strong technical and problem-solving skills, will be instrumental in completing these tasks, enhancing user experiences, and maintaining the overall integrity and security of our Perceptive Content (ImageNow) and DocuSign environment. 

Qualifications:

  • Bachelors Degree and at least 3 years or relevant work experience. Substantial relevant experience may be considered in lieu of a degree

  • Strong communication skills and the ability to lead discussions with stakeholders to gather and define requirements

  • Working knowledge of C#, .NET and Java Script

  • Experience with basic database and system admin process

  • Experience with investigation, debugging and recovering data from a wide range of issues and errors  Previous experience with database programming (SQL Server and Oracle)

  • Knowledge of software design and use of software tools

Anticipated hiring range : $80,000 - $95,000

Benefits Include: The choice between 3 different health plans; vision and dental insurance; life insurance; benefits savings accounts; starting with 22 days of paid time off a year in addition to 12 or more paid holidays; 8 weeks of paid parental leave; short term disability; up to $4,360 after your first year for combined use of tuition toward a degree-seeking program or up to $2,000 for professional development including classes, certification training and conferences; and more!
